Foros del Web » Programando para Internet » PHP »

redireccionamiento de paginas

Estas en el tema de redireccionamiento de paginas en el foro de PHP en Foros del Web. Hola amigos. tengo la siguiente duda, probablemente ya se ha hablado de esto anteriormente pero la verdad no encuentro algo que me ayude en mi ...
  #1 (permalink)  
Antiguo 09/02/2009, 20:35
 
Fecha de Ingreso: diciembre-2008
Mensajes: 26
Antigüedad: 15 años, 4 meses
Puntos: 0
Información redireccionamiento de paginas

Hola amigos.

tengo la siguiente duda, probablemente ya se ha hablado de esto anteriormente pero la verdad no encuentro algo que me ayude en mi inquietud. La consulta es sencilla, lo que quiero hacer es direccionar una pagina, pero con las siguientes restricciones. Por ejemplo, un usuario esta navegando en una tienda virtual pero quiere comprar los productos, el sistema verifica si ha iniciado sesion si no lo ha hecho entonces lo redirecciona a la pagina de inicio de sesion, lo que deseo es que despues de haber iniciado sesion me direccione la pagina a la pagina a donde supuestamente tendria que haber seguido si hubiera estado logeado desde el principio.

No se si me he hecho entender. Si me pudieran ayudar se lo agradeceria muchisimo.

De antemano muchisimas gracias por sus respuestas
  #2 (permalink)  
Antiguo 09/02/2009, 21:05
Avatar de dadabit  
Fecha de Ingreso: febrero-2009
Ubicación: Coahuila, México
Mensajes: 145
Antigüedad: 15 años, 3 meses
Puntos: 1
Respuesta: redireccionamiento de paginas

header("location: pagina.php");
  #3 (permalink)  
Antiguo 09/02/2009, 21:08
 
Fecha de Ingreso: diciembre-2008
Mensajes: 26
Antigüedad: 15 años, 4 meses
Puntos: 0
Respuesta: redireccionamiento de paginas

muchas gracias por contestar tan rapido dadabit. a lo que voy es tratar de hacerlo dinamico, por ejemplo, este codigo:

$MM_restrictGoTo = "form.php";
if (!((isset($_SESSION['MM_Username'])) && (isAuthorized("",$MM_authorizedUsers, $_SESSION['MM_Username'], $_SESSION['MM_UserGroup'])))) {
$MM_qsChar = "?";
$MM_referrer = $_SERVER['PHP_SELF'];
if (strpos($MM_restrictGoTo, "?")) $MM_qsChar = "&";
if (isset($QUERY_STRING) && strlen($QUERY_STRING) > 0)
$MM_referrer .= "?" . $QUERY_STRING;
$MM_restrictGoTo = $MM_restrictGoTo. $MM_qsChar . "accesscheck=" . urlencode($MM_referrer);
header("Location: ". $MM_restrictGoTo);
exit;
}





if (isset($accesscheck)) {
$_SESSION['PrevUrl'] = $accesscheck;
//session_register('PrevUrl');
}
$MM_redirectLoginSuccess = "Index.html";

if (isset($_SESSION['PrevUrl']) && true) {
$MM_redirectLoginSuccess = $_SESSION['PrevUrl'];
}

header("Location: " . $MM_redirectLoginSuccess );

pero la verdad no lo entiendo y no se como trabajarlo, no se mi me podrias ayudar.

Muchas gracias
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 20:06.